Sandra Peel is a scholar working on Immunology, Small Animals and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sandra Peel has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 283 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Immunology, 1 paper in Small Animals and 1 paper in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Sandra Peel's work include Reproductive System and Pregnancy (3 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(1 paper) and Microfluidic and Bio-sensing Technologies (1 paper). Sandra Peel is often cited by papers focused on Reproductive System and Pregnancy (3 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(1 paper) and Microfluidic and Bio-sensing Technologies (1 paper). Sandra Peel coll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om. Sandra Peel's co-authors include Ian Stewart, Patrick A. Fletcher and Diana M. Cowen and has published in prestigious journals such as British Journal of Cancer, Advances in anatomy, embryology and cell biology and Anatomy and Embryology.

All Works

7 of 7 papers shown
1.
Peel, Sandra. (1989). Granulated Metrial Gland Cells. Advances in anatomy, embryology and cell biology. 115. 1–112. 179 indexed citations
2.
Stewart, Ian & Sandra Peel. (1980). Granulated metrial gland cells at implantation sites of the pregnant mouse uterus. Anatomy and Embryology. 160(2). 227–238. 56 indexed citations
3.
Stewart, Ian & Sandra Peel. (1979). Changes in the metrial gland of the rat uterus following ovariectomy on day 10 of pregnancy. Anatomy and Embryology. 156(1). 103–114. 8 indexed citations
4.
Peel, Sandra & Ian Stewart. (1979). Ultrastructural changes in the rat metrial gland in the latter half of pregnancy. Anatomy and Embryology. 155(2). 209–219. 13 indexed citations
5.
Peel, Sandra & Diana M. Cowen. (1973). A Quantitative Morphological Analysis of the Response of a Transplantable Rat Fibrosarcoma to Cyclophosphamide. British Journal of Cancer. 27(1). 72–79. 2 indexed citations
6.
Peel, Sandra & Diana M. Cowen. (1972). The Effect of Cyclophosphamide on the Growth and Cellular Kinetics of a Transplantable Rat Fibrosarcoma. British Journal of Cancer. 26(4). 304–314. 6 indexed citations
7.
Peel, Sandra & Patrick A. Fletcher. (1969). Changes occurring during the growth of Ehrlich ascites cells in vivo. European Journal of Cancer (1965). 5(6). 581–589. 19 indexed citations
